Web13 mei 2014 · If possible, isolate infected animals to decrease the potential for disease transmission. Prevention and Control of Pinkeye. Fly control is an essential part of … Web18 jun. 2024 · As of this writing, the approved products to treat pinkeye in beef cattle include long-acting tetracycline products (for example, LA-200®, Biomycin 200®, etc.) and tulathromycin (Draxxin®). There may be resistance in some herds to these treatments, especially to oxytetracycline, and a veterinarian may need to conduct a culture and …
